Google Authorship Rewards Content Creators, but Considers Anonymous Articles 'Unsuccessful'
Google rewards quality content, and with regard to Penguin and Panda updates, outstanding writing prowess has now become the benchmark for improved search engine rankings. This is bad news for those website owners who believe in churning out junk articles at throwaway prices, and placing purchased links or embracing other black hat SEO tactics.
Google authorship has taken the Internet world by storm. And, ...
... as far as rewards are concerned, the benefits of fair search engine ranking are not only enjoyed by website owners, but individual content writing professionals are given their due credit and approbation. To make the most out of author rank, writers must come out of their closet to claim their web copy, online magazine articles, and guest posts making use of Google+ profiles.
Writers who publish compelling info on websites or blogs will be rewarded by Google in terms of improved search engine rankings.
So, it's high time that online businesses have a word with their developers or designers to integrate the Google+ authorship markup to the website.
The mindset that company content should remain anonymous should be changed for once and for all. For example, if you have an online business, web copy, articles, and posts must be author-credited. However, ensure that the information published on the site is well written, well-researched, and devoid of fluff. And, when web copy and blog posts are well written, they will be shared more by visitors.
Businesses are Embracing Quality Content Wholeheartedly
Since 2012, the attitude of Internet marketers changed drastically. As far as content marketing is concerned, it is no more a second thought but an essential foundation for successful online marketing. It's quality information that attracts visitors, improves traffic, builds credibility, improves social media sharing and helps your company improve sales figures.
To make web copy and articles interesting and compelling, you need to walk the extra mile to know your targeted audience, learn what they need, get familiar with their likes, dislikes, and frustrations. Once you know your potential clients, it will be easy for you to churn out information that gets attention, stands out, and a has enduring shelf life.
